This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] DP83822IF:100Base-FX 单模 RX 不工作

Guru**** 2482225 points
Other Parts Discussed in Thread: DP83822IF

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/interface-group/interface/f/interface-forum/673340/dp83822if-100base-fx-single-mode-rx-not-working

器件型号:DP83822IF

您好!

我们在将 DP83822IF PHY 连接到单模 SFP 光学收发器时遇到问题。 我们将“DP83822 EVM”套件与 SPF 端口配合使用,并将 Finisar FTLF1323P1BTR 收发器连接在一起。 PHY 通过 MII 接口连接到 MAC。

问题出在收发器/PHY 的 RX 侧。 在传输过程中、大约有一半的数据包丢失。 TX 侧正常工作。

收发器为100BASE-FX 单模。 我们尝试了其他多模式收发器(Avago)、它们工作正常。

对于配置、我们使用自举引脚。 (我们仅启用 FX_EN 位)。

我们的硬件连接如下所示(尽管我们也尝试了不同的设置):

您是否知道问题可能在哪里、或者我们还可以检查其他什么?

此致、

旅行

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Vaclav、

    DP83822具有一个电流模式线路驱动器。 由于偏置、RD 和 TD 引脚上都需要0.1uF 直流阻断电容器。
    另外、请在 PHY 和直流阻断电容器之间的 TD 和 RD 引脚上设置49.9欧姆的上拉电阻器。

    有关建议的配置、请参阅第9.2.2节。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Vaclav、

    您是否有机会了解建议的终止?
    此外、您能否为我提供一个寄存器转储? 我想知道寄存器0x0到0x1F 以及0x467和0x468的值。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Ross、

    正如9.2.2节所述、我们连接了 PHY 和收发器。 (阻断电容器和上拉电阻)。 但问题仍然相同。 传输过程中大约有一半的数据包丢失(使用 ping 命令进行测试)。

    以下是寄存器转储:

    0x00   0x3100    
    0x01   0x784D    
    0x02   0x2000    
    0x03   0xA240    
    0x04   0x0181    
    0x05   0x0000    
    0x06   0x0004    
    0x07   0x2001    
    0x08   0x0000    
    0x09   0x0000    
    0x0A   0x4100    
    0x0B   0x1000    
    0x0C   0x0000    
    0x0D   0x401F    
    0x0E   0x0000    
    0x0F   0x0000    
    0x10   0x2A05    
    0x11   0x0108    
    0x12   0x8200    
    0x13   0x0000    
    0x14   0x00FF    
    0x15   0x014B    
    0x16   0x0100    
    0x17   0x004D    
    0x18   0x0400    
    0x19   0x0021    
    0x1A   0x0000    
    0x1b   0x007D    
    0x1C   0x05EE    
    0x1D   0x0000    
    0x1E   0x0002    
    0x1f   0x0000    
    0x467   0x08C3
    0x468   0x0000    

    我们还尝试了不同的单模收发器(Avago)、这些收发器开箱即用。 因此、PHY 和 Finisar 收发器之间似乎存在某种不兼容性。

    此致、

    旅行